Primega Gets Nasdaq's Noncompliance Notification Regarding Minimum Bid Price Deficiency

MT Newswires Live
14 Mar

Primega Group Holdings (PGHL) said Friday it received a Nasdaq noncompliance notification, stating that the company no longer fulfills the regulator's minimum bid price requirement of $1 per share for continued listing based on the closing bid price from Jan. 28 to March 11.

The regulator has given a 180 calendar days compliance time, or until Sept. 8 for the company to regain compliance, Primega said, adding that the notice has no immediate impact on its ordinary shares' listing.

Primega's stock was down 2.3% in recent Friday premarket activity.
